Spread Spectrum technique is a digital passband technique. It uses a special code which is known only to the transmitter and receiver of that message. The special code appears as a noise signal to the jammer who tries to jam the channel. In this paper, we present the Direct Sequence Spread Spectrum. Firstly, we show an overview of Direct Sequence Spread Spectrum, then, we simulate Direct Sequence Spread Spectrum using MATLAB. The results of simulation are presented in this paper. We are clearly…
